About The Roe

The Roe is a detached wooden lodge in Llannerch Holiday Park, North Wales. This single-storey property sits in peaceful surroundings near St Asaph, Denbighshire. Perfect for families with its three bedrooms and two bathrooms - you'll have space to spread out and relax.

Set in a small, quiet holiday park with shared lawns and woodland play areas. Want to fish? They provide a free river fishing permit! Golfers get 10% off at the nearby course. You can even buy fresh eggs when available - breakfast sorted! And after exploring, sink into your private hot tub with a glass of something cold. Who needs fancy hotels?

The accommodation features a king-size bedroom with en-suite shower, a twin room and a smaller 2'6" twin bedroom. The family bathroom includes a bath with shower over. The heart of The Roe is its open-plan living space with kitchen, dining area with extending table and a sitting area warmed by a woodburning stove - perfect for those chillier Welsh evenings.

Visit St Asaph Cathedral (3 miles, 8 minutes), try horse riding at the on-site riding school, enjoy Tweedmill Shopping Outlet with dining discounts (2 miles, 5 minutes), or explore Bodelwyddan Castle (5 miles, 12 minutes). Rhyl's sandy beaches are just 9 miles away (20 minutes).

The Roe offers that rare combo of relaxation and adventure. Dogs are welcome too, so the whole family can enjoy this Welsh getaway. Soak in the hot tub, fire up the BBQ, or cozy up by the woodburner - this lodge has it all.

Does this cottage have a hot tub?
Yes, The Roe features a private hot tub on the patio area. It's regularly maintained and ready for use throughout your stay.
Is it pet friendly?
Yes, The Roe welcomes one well-behaved dog. The surrounding area offers plenty of walking opportunities for you and your four-legged companion.
What sleeping arrangements are available?
The lodge has three bedrooms: one king-size with en-suite, one standard twin room and one smaller 2'6" twin room. The accommodation sleeps up to six guests comfortably.
Are there any special discounts available?
Guests receive 10% discount off the nearby golf course and at both the Tower coffee shop and dining at Tweedmill Shopping Outlet. Free river fishing permits are also provided.
What outdoor space does the property have?
The Roe has a private patio with hot tub, furniture and barbecue. Guests also have access to shared lawns and woodland play areas within the holiday park.
Is the property accessible for people with mobility issues?
The lodge is single-storey and a wheelchair ramp is available upon request. This makes it potentially suitable for guests with mobility requirements.
What activities are available nearby?
Nearby activities include fishing (free river permit provided), golf, horse riding at the on-site riding school and shopping at Tweedmill Outlet. St Asaph offers dining, pubs and a historic cathedral.
What kitchen facilities are provided?
The kitchen is fully equipped with an electric oven and hob, microwave, fridge, freezer and dishwasher. All the essentials for self-catering are provided.
